Explore The Majestic Svartisen Glacier And Its Remarkable Geological History In Northern Norway


Svartisen Glacier stands as a monumental natural landmark, representing one of the most significant ice formations in Europe. Spanning over 370 square kilometers, this massive glacier is divided into eastern and western sections, stretching across the municipalities of Rana, Meløy, and Rødøy. Known for its striking deep blue ice and dramatic crevasses, the glacier offers a profound look at the glacial history of Norway, providing visitors with an opportunity to witness a landscape shaped by ancient frozen forces.


The glacier is remarkably accessible, with the Engenbreen arm situated only 20 to 30 meters above sea level, making it one of the lowest glaciers on the continent. While the glacier was once a singular, unified mass of ice in the 1770s, it has since retreated and fragmented into its current state. This tour focuses on the Austerdalsisen arm, which is reached by traveling through the scenic Røvassdalen valley and crossing the Svartisvatnet lake by boat to reach the base.


Participants will learn about the historical significance of the region, including the legacy of explorers like Karl Johan Westermark, who dedicated his life to studying these icy expanses. The narrative of the glacier is deeply intertwined with the local communities that have lived in its shadow for generations. By examining the surroundings and the geological evolution of the ice, guests gain a comprehensive understanding of how this massive natural feature continues to influence the local environment today.
